Pair of 1960s Stilux Articulating Sconces

Sold Sold
  • Description
    Pair of 1960s Stilux Articulating Sconces in the manner of Gino Sarfatti. Executed in brass and green painted aluminum. Sconces pivot up/down and left/right on a ball joint. Wired for US electrical . Custom patinated brass backplates. Accommodates a single US medium base 60w maximum bulb.

    Stilux was one of the most innovative lighting design companies in Italy during the midcentury era. Their designs have been long sought after by collectors in the know.
